AMD

RadeonT 610M

The RadeonT 610M is manufactured by AMD. It was released in January 3 2023. It features the RDNA 2.0 architecture. The core clock ranges from 400 MHz to 2200 MHz. It has 128 shading units. The thermal design power (TDP) is 15W. Manufactured using 5 nm process technology. It features 2 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 1,068 points.

AMD

FirePro W4170M

The FirePro W4170M is manufactured by AMD. It was released in April 23 2015. It features the GCN 1.0 architecture. The core clock ranges from 825 MHz to 900 MHz. It has 384 shading units. The thermal design power (TDP) is 150W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 1,052 points.

Graphics Performance

The RadeonT 610M scores 1,068 and the FirePro W4170M reaches 1,052 in the G3D Mark benchmark — just a 1.5% difference, making them near-identical in rasterization performance. The RadeonT 610M is built on RDNA 2.0 while the FirePro W4170M uses GCN 1.0, both on 5 nm vs 28 nm. Shader units: 128 (RadeonT 610M) vs 384 (FirePro W4170M). Raw compute: 0.5632 TFLOPS (RadeonT 610M) vs 0.6912 TFLOPS (FirePro W4170M). Boost clocks: 2200 MHz vs 900 MHz.

Video Memory (VRAM)

The RadeonT 610M comes with 512 MB of VRAM, while the FirePro W4170M has 4 GB. The FirePro W4170M offers 700% more capacity, crucial for higher resolutions and texture-heavy games. Bus width: 64-bit vs 64-bit. L2 Cache: 2 MB (RadeonT 610M) vs 0.25 MB (FirePro W4170M) — the RadeonT 610M has significantly larger on-die cache to reduce VRAM reliance.

Media & Encoding

Hardware encoder: VCN 3.0 (RadeonT 610M) vs VCE 1.0 (FirePro W4170M). Decoder: VCN 3.0 vs UVD 4.0. Supported codecs: H.264,H.265,VP9,AV1,JPEG (RadeonT 610M) vs H.264,MPEG-4,VC-1,MPEG-2 (FirePro W4170M).
